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 1 lb chicken breasts (2 pieces): Choose fresh, boneless, and skinless chicken for quick cooking and tender bites.
  • 1 tsp salt: Enhances natural chicken flavors and balances the sweetness of the honey.
  • 1 tsp garlic powder: Adds depth and subtle garlicky notes that complement fresh garlic perfectly.
  • ½ tsp black pepper: Gives a hint of warmth and slight spice.
  • 3 tbsp cornstarch: Creates a crispy outer layer, sealing in the juicy chicken inside.
  • 2 tbsp avocado oil: Ideal for high-heat searing without overpowering flavors.
  • 6 cloves garlic (minced): Fresh garlic ensures an irresistible aroma and vibrant taste.
  • 1 tsp red chili pepper flakes (optional): Adds a gentle kick and visual interest if you like a bit of heat.
  • ¼ cup honey: The star sweetness that binds the glaze beautifully.
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ce: Brings umami and a subtle salty contrast.
  • 2 tbsp lemon juice: Brightens the sauce with fresh acidity.
  • 3 tbsp water: Helps thin the glaze for an even coating.
  • 2 tbsp cold butter: Finishes the sauce with a glossy, rich texture.
  • Chopped chives (for garnish): Adds a fresh pop of color and mild onion flavor.

How to Make 20 Minute Honey Garlic Chicken Bites Recipe

Step 1: Prep the Chicken

Begin by cutting the chicken breasts into bite-sized cubes, approximately 1 inch each. Season them with salt, black pepper, and garlic powder evenly, ensuring every piece is well-coated for maximum flavor in every bite.

Step 2: Coat the Chicken

Sprinkle the cornstarch over the seasoned chicken and give it a good mix. The cornstarch is the secret behind that irresistible crispy crust once fried, keeping the inside juicy and tender.

Step 3: Sear the Chicken

Heat avocado o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, add the chicken cubes and sear them until they turn golden brown and crispy, about 5 minutes on each side. Then, remove the chicken from the pan and set it aside, ready to be glazed.

Step 4: Create the Sauce Base

Lower the heat to medium-low and add the minced garlic and optional red chili pepper flakes into the same skillet. Sauté for about one minute until the garlic becomes fragrant and the chili flakes release their subtle heat — this step fills your kitchen with an inviting aroma.

Step 5: Build the Honey Garlic Glaze

Pour in the honey, soy sauce, lemon juice, and water, stirring continuously. Let this mixture simmer for roughly two minutes until the sauce starts to thicken and coat the back of your spoon, setting the stage for that perfect glossy finish.

Step 6: Add the Finishing Touch

Drop in the cold butter and swirl the pan gently until it melts completely into the sauce. This final step transforms the glaze, giving it a silky richness and irresistible shine.

Step 7: Coat the Chicken Thoroughly

Return the golden chicken bites to the skillet and toss them gently in the luscious sauce. Make sure every piece is fully coated to lock in flavor and create that wonderful sticky texture.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Place leftover honey garlic chicken bites in an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. The flavors meld beautifully overnight, making them just as tasty the next day.

Freezing

If you’d like to keep them longer, freeze the cooked chicken bites in a freezer-safe container for up to a month.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ating to maintain texture and flavor.

Reheating

Reheat gently in a skillet over medium heat or in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through. Avoid microwaving if possible, as it can make the chicken lose its crispiness.

FAQs

Can I use chicken thighs instead of breasts?

Absolutely! Chicken thighs offer a bit more juiciness and flavor, and they work wonderfully in this recipe with just a slight adjustment in cooking time.

Is it okay to skip the chili flakes?

Yes, the red chili flakes are optional and only add a bit of spice. The dish is delicious without them, especially if you prefer milder flavors.

Can I make this gluten-free?

Definitely. Just be sure to use gluten-free soy sauce or tamari to keep the dish safe for gluten-sensitive diets.

How can I make the sauce thicker?

If you prefer a thicker glaze, allow the sauce to simmer a little longer before adding the butter, or add a tiny bit more cornstarch slurry to help it thicken up.

What’s the best oil substitute for avocado oil?

Neutral oils with a high smoke point like canola, vegetable, or grapeseed oil are great alternatives that won’t interfere with the dish’s flavor.

Ingredients

Chicken and Seasoning

  • 1 lb chicken breasts (2 pieces), c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• 3 tbsp cornstarch

Sauce and Garnish

  • 2 tbsp avocado oil
  • 6 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tsp red chili pepper flakes (optional)
  • ¼ cup honey
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p lemon juice
  • 3 tbsp water (to thin out the glaze)
  • 2 tbsp cold butter
  • Chopped chives, for garnish


Instructions

  1. Prepare the chicken: Cut the chicken breasts into 1-inch cubes. In a bowl, season the chicken pieces evenly with salt, black pepper, and garlic powder.
  2. Coat with cornstarch: Add cornstarch to the seasoned chicken and mix thoroughly to ensure each piece is lightly coated.
  3. Sear the chicken: Heat avocado o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the chicken pieces and cook for about 5 minutes on each side until they become golden brown and crispy.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side.
  4. Sauté garlic and chili flakes: Reduce the heat to medium-low. In the same skillet, add minced garlic and red chili pepper flakes (if using). Sauté for 1 minute until fragrant, stirring frequently to avoid burning.
  5. Make the honey garlic sauce: Stir in the honey, soy sauce, lemon juice, and water into the skillet. Cook and stir the mixture for about 2 minutes until the sauce slightly thickens.
  6. Add butter to glaze: Add the cold butter to the sauce and swirl the pan until the sauce turns glossy and rich.
  7. Combine chicken with sauce: Return the seared chicken pieces to the skillet. Toss the chicken thoroughly to coat each piece evenly with the honey garlic glaze.
  8. Serve: Garnish with chopped chives and serve immediately while hot. Enjoy your delicious honey garlic chicken bites!

Notes

  • For extra crispiness, double coat the chicken with cornstarch before frying.
  • Adjust the amount of red chili flakes based on your heat preference or omit for a milder flavor.
  • This dish pairs well with steamed rice or sautéed vegetables for a complete meal.
  • Use avocado oil for its high smoke point and neutral flavor, but vegetable or canola oil can be substituted.
  • Make sure the butter is cold before adding to the sauce to achieve a smooth, shiny glaze.
